Profile
- Name: 이레 / Lee Re
- Profession: Actress
- Birthdate: 2006-Mar-12 (age 20)
- Birthplace: Gwangju, South Jeolla Province, South Korea
- Talent agency: Noon Company
TV Shows
- Shin's Project (tvN, 2025)
- Hellbound 2 (Netflix, 2024)
- Castaway Diva (tvN, 2023)
- O'PENing Stock of High School (tvN, 2022)
- Hellbound (Netflix, 2021)
- Hometown (tvN, 2021)
- Move to Heaven (Netflix, 2021) cameo
- Hello, Me! (KBS2, 2021)
- Start-Up (tvN, 2020)
- Memories of the Alhambra (tvN, 2018)
- Radio Romance (KBS2, 2018)
- Witch's Court (KBS2, 2017)
- Please Come Back, Mister (SBS, 2016)
- Six Flying Dragons (SBS, 2015)
- Super Daddy Yul (tvN, 2015)
- Oh Ja Ryong is Coming (MBC, 2012)
- The Chaser (SBS, 2012)
- Goodbye Wife (Channel A, 2012)
Movies
- Peninsula (2020)
- Miss & Mrs. Cops (2019)
- Innocent Witness (2018) cameo
- Seven Years of Night (2018)
- Your Name (2017) dubbing
- A Melody To Remember (2016)
- How to Steal a Dog (2014)
- Hope (2013)
Recognitions
- 2021 35th KBS Drama Awards: Best Young Actress (Hello, Me!)
- 2020 29th Buil Film Awards: Best Supporting Actress (Peninsula)
- 2017 31st KBS Drama Awards: Best Child Actress (Witch's Court)
- 2015 4th Marie Claire Film Festival: Best New Actress (How to Steal a Dog)
- 2014 4th Beijing International Film Festival: Best Supporting Actress (Hope)
Trivia
- Education: Korean International Christian School, Chung-Ang University (Theater and Film) attending
